[프로그래머스] lv.1 명예의 전당(1)

Jenny·2023년 7월 19일
0
post-thumbnail

문제

https://school.programmers.co.kr/learn/courses/30/lessons/138477

정답

def solution(k, score):
    answer = []
    prize = []
    for i in range(len(score)):
        prize.append(score[i])
        prize.sort(reverse=True)
        
        if len(prize) < k:
            answer.append(prize[len(prize)-1])
        else:
            answer.append(prize[k-1])
            
    return answer

과정

전날 해결을 못해서 담날 다시 봐서 풀었다.
순회를 하면서 sort를 시켜주는게 중요함
sorted는 정렬한 걸 새로운 배열로 반환해주고, sort는 원본 배열을 정렬해줌

profile
Developer로의 여정

1개의 댓글

comment-user-thumbnail
2023년 7월 20일

정말 유익한 글이었습니다.

답글 달기